Talking Forged rods for the LFX engine!

I'm in the works of getting a batch of forged 4340 H beam rods for the LFX engine made. I'll end up 2 individual rods left that I can't make a full set out of. I'm thinking I would like to send at least one of them out for fatigue testing and analysis to really get an idea of how much of a beating they can take.

I'm sure I could have it done at the manufacturer, but I would like to have it third party tested.

I did stumble across this: http://www.chryslertestservices.com/...urability.html , and have already tried contacting them, awaiting a response.

In your guys' travels have you ever had this done, or know of another source, or multiple sources I could have this testing done at? Sorry if this is in the wrong section, the forced induction area just seemed like the best bet.
